I was going to start this thread when I got out of my 4pm class, but this works as well. Listened to most of the broadcast on 88.1, and here's what Curt had to say about the freshmen class.
Tracy Pontius (PG from Illinois) - Curt said she is unlike any PG he has ever had here, by that she can shot it from long range. Said she could spell Kate so Kate can play at the 2
Lauren Prochaska - Curt said while she is known for her offense, she is also a great defender. Curt thinks the wings in the MAC will have fits having to deal with the defense of Prochaska and Lindsay Goldsberry
Bianca Hooten (Wing from Canton) - Curt says she is in the mold of a Carin Horne, and it'll be fun to watch her develop over 4 years
Crystal Murdaugh (Forward from Dublin) - Curt said she has been great during practice and could be a 3 or 4. Thinks that at the 4 she could give the other 4's in the league fits. Also said she could start from day one
Jennifer Uhl (Forward from Wadsworth) - Curt said she has been dealing with mono and hasn't been on the floor for all the practices
Kelly Zuercher (Center from Orrville) - Curt said that she is the enforcer, and like Hooten it'll be fun to watch her develop over four years
Chelsea Albert (Center from Michigan) - Curt said that like Murdaugh, Chelsea could start from day one.
As for the preseason polls, as I expected OU is the favorite in the East, with Ball State the favorite in the West and the favorite to win the tournament. Here is the rest of the poll (mac-sports.com doesn't have the number of votes up yet):
East
1. Ohio
2. BG
3. Miami
4. Kent
5. Buffalo
6. Akron
West
1. Ball State
2. Northern Illinois
3. Eastern Michigan
4. Western Michigan
5. Toledo
6. Central Michigan
